## Job Description

## What You'll Do
- Own end-to-end technical production for Harvey's all-hands, exec broadcasts, town halls, and internal leadership events — from pre-production planning through live execution and post-event capture.
- Build and run the playbooks: run-of-show, rehearsal cadence, presenter prep, backup paths, and incident response so live events are predictable, not heroic.
- Define and maintain Harvey's conference-room and event-space AV standards across our global office footprint — designing reference setups that scale with each new buildout.
- Run the livestream and broadcast stack end-to-end: cameras, switchers, encoders, audio, captioning, and the platforms we distribute through (Zoom, Slack, internal channels).
- Partner with Internal Communications on cadence, content flow, and exec speaker prep, and with Brand & Creative on graphics, motion packages, lower-thirds, and on-screen identity.
- Manage external production vendors, freelance crews, and AV integrators — scoping work, negotiating rates, and holding them to Harvey's quality bar.
- Lead AV readiness for new office openings in lockstep with Workplace, IT/Network, and Real Estate.
- Capture, edit, and archive event footage for internal reuse (recap reels, onboarding content, leadership clips), and own the studio kit and gear inventory across offices.
- Operate as the on-call escalation point for A/V incidents during high-stakes events and as the BizTech subject-matter expert on media production technology decisions.

## What You Have
- Minimum 6 years of experience in live event production, broadcast operations, corporate A/V, or a closely related field, including hands-on technical roles before moving into program ownership.
- Experience commissioning A/V in new office buildouts alongside architects, GCs, and low-voltage integrators.
- Demonstrated ownership of recurring high-visibility live events (all-hands, keynotes, customer summits, broadcasts) at a company or production house operating at meaningful scale.
- Deep working knowledge of the production stack: video switchers (e.g., ATEM, Tricaster), encoders (e.g., NDI, SRT), wireless and wired audio, lighting fundamentals, and livestream platforms.
- Practical experience designing or operating conference-room and event-space AV — DSPs, ceiling mics, video bars, room control systems, and Zoom Rooms / Google Meet integrations.
- Track record of managing external production vendors and freelance crews, including scoping SOWs, holding QA standards, and running post-event reviews.
- Strong communication and stakeholder management skills, especially with non-technical teams and executive stakeholders.
- Ability to thrive in a fast-paced, high-growth, and global environment.

## Bonus Points
- Experience standing up an in-house production capability from scratch at a hyper-growth technology company.
- Background supporting executive communications or working directly with C-suite and IR teams on broadcast-quality leadership content.
- Familiarity with editing and post workflows and motion/graphics handoff with brand teams.
- Comfort with media asset management systems and content archival best practices.
